What You’ll Accomplish

  • Get to know the team as well as the systems currently in place for recording and reconciling bank activity. Once fully onboarded, the role will transition to identifying and implementing any opportunities to increase efficiency and streamline operations.
  • Review monthly bank activity following proper internal control procedures to record and report accurate cash flows and assets in general ledger as well as manage abandoned property procedures for outstanding checks issued to vendors and employees.
  • Reconcile and analyze monthly general ledger accounts in Financial Edge to ensure transactions are accurate and properly recorded and to ensure the accuracy and completeness of bank statement data on the Museum’s books. Submit reconciliations for monthly review by Manager.
  • Assist the Controller and Manager in the annual financial statement audit in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les to ensure accuracy of statements for use by the management, trustees, and outside agencies.
  • Engage in cross training within department and act as primary backup to functions assigned by Manager.

What We’re Looking For (Competencies)

  • Technical skills: This role will require you to be familiar with US GAAP guidelines and regulations but also be systems savvy including presenting a proficiency in Excel and experience with accounting software packages.
  • Growth Mindset: This role will require you to be curious about ways to improve our current systems and procedures. We are looking for someone who enjoys the process of getting better at what you do and seeking out the feedback that improves your ability to learn from your experiences.
  • Attention to detail This role will require you to manage a lot of daily data required to accurately report our financial activity to the Museum. We are looking for someone who does not let important details slip through the cracks and lives up to the daily, weekly, monthly and annual commitments required to provide accurate financial reporting.

Since its founding in 1830, the Museum of Science has been at the cutting edge of scientific study and education. Today it has become an iconic symbol of the city’s long cultural and technological history – and future. Within its ¾ mile long building, the Museum of Science includes:

• 10,000 square foot Hall of Human Life, allowing visitors to explore how they engage with their own bodies

• Thomson Theater of Electricity, home to the world’s largest Van de Graaf generator which makes indoor lightning

• Charles Hayden Planetarium, the most technologically advanced theater in New England

• Mugar Omni Theater, New England’s only dome IMAX screen

• Award-winning pre-K – 8 engineering curriculum, EiE, reaching 1.3 million students each year
